At some point, I guess it was at the beginning of the 2013 tour with Kim Shattuck, I was quite worried he was going to burn himself as the shows always seemed so intense to me then, but time as proven me wrong and there must be a way to do that(at least for Black Francis!!) because he does actually still deliver insanely. Maybe part of the explanation could be found with the "bel canto" lessons he took with his neighbour before Dog in the Sand(if I remember well), you know, understanding how to adjust the output of your voice so it sounds the way you want without being painful, that kind of stuff.

Anyway, Black Francis always was an awesome performer, and has a real talent for voice modulation, seemed pretty obvious to me when I saw him live solo acoustic in 2003: how much energy his singing can have without the intensity being exactly equivalent to "loudness". He sure worked his balance an incredible way through the years, and that might be the reason why he's still able to kick ass that much ;0
